Brewdog opens 2nd Irish venue

Independent Scottish craft brewer BrewDog opens its newest bar in the centre of Cork city today when BrewDog Cork throws open its doors at 12:00pm at 1-2 Courthouse Street, just off Washington Street, in the heart of the city’s thriving craft beer scene.

 

BrewDog Cork represents the seventh venue operated by Westside Leisure who've been running bars across the Cork city for 40 years.

The venue has two floors with a bar on each floor, plus a Mezzanine.

Each bar will have 30 taps of craft beer from BrewDog plus curated local guest breweries, with a take-away service available for those needing beers to go.

With the opening of the Cork outlet today, Brewdog now has over 100 bars across the globe, exporting to 60 countries and it has breweries in Columbus, Ohio; Berlin, Germany and Brisbane Australia.
